I am trying to do a linear min problem with " linprog" in matlab. I am wondering the difference of using "options" or not. whats the difference between " dual-simplex'' or not?

Dear scully, "dual-simplex" or "interior-point" are different algorithms to provide a solution of the linear programming problem. They have both their advantages and disadvantages. To get an idea of what they do, and why choosing one of them instead of the other, try get an insight here: https://it.mathworks.com/help/optim/ug/linear-programming-algorithms.html?searchHighlight=linear%2520programming
